Saving for Retirement:
Plan ahead for a satisfactory retirement.  Contribute to a 403(b), and/or 457(b) account on a tax-free basis.  Set aside as much as $16,500 in 2009, plus an additional $5,500 if you are age 50 or older by 12/31/09.  For more information consult your financial planner.  If you don't have a financial planner, you may use those provided by San Diego County Schools Fringe Benefits Consortium. For assistance, contact Randy Thill at 760.845.2596 or by email at thillr@nationwide.com

Palomar College also offers a Roth 403(b) planThe only Roth 403(b) vendor is the Fringe Benefits Consortium.  Investment options are outlined in the forms packet on the page headed "Nationwide Enrollment Form".
